Sunday we will celebrate the resurrection of our Lord and I wanted to create a card for this special day.
The is a 6x5.5 inch card and the top was cut with 2 of the Curve Borders #2.  Lace Corners were attached with Glue and Seal, the Lacy Square was popped up for dimension.  The crosses are some that I had in my stash and I believe they have been discontinued.  The large cross was embossed with the Sizzix Lattice Embossing folder and also popped up.  The small cross was inked with Ranger's Gold Ink Dabber.
